Description
The Prospective Review V3: A Quarterly Journal Of Theology And Literature (1847) is a book edited by John Chapman. It is a collection of essays and articles that were published in the quarterly journal of the same name. The book covers various topics related to theology and literature, including essays on the Bible, Christian theology, and literary criticism. It features contributions from notable writers and thinkers of the time, such as Thomas Carlyle, John Stuart Mill, and William Wordsworth. The book is divided into several sections, each focusing on a different theme or topic. Overall, The Prospective Review V3 provides a comprehensive insight into the intellectual and cultural climate of the mid-19th century, and is a valuable resource for scholars and readers interested in the history of theology and literature.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
